LITTLE KNOWN FACTS ABOUT FORBES MEDIA.

Little Known Facts About Forbes Media.

Nina Gould can be a electronic media government identified for making partaking articles encounters that delight and inspire audiences. As Main Solution Officer of Forbes, she prospects a team of planet-class item professionals, designers, e-commerce leaders along with other authorities centered on creating the items that form the Forbes manufactur

read more